Isopentane is a naturally occurring compound that is emitted from bay-leaved willows, aspens, balsam poplars, European oaks, European larches, European firs, sorbs, silver fir trees, red bilberry shrubs, bilberry shrubs, ferns and deciduous mosses (1). Isopentane may be produced naturally in ocean sediments (2). Feb 15, 2015 · Feb 15, 2015. Butane, or C4H 10, has two structural (also called constitutional) isomers called normal butane, or unbranched butane, and isobutane, or i-butane. According to IUPAC nomenclature, these isomers are called simply butane and 2-methylpropane. As you know, isomers are molecules that have the same molecular formula but different ...
